Highlights
- Litchfield Park has 85.5% less rainy days than West Palm Beach.
- Litchfield Park has 23.5% more Sunny Days than West Palm Beach.
- On the BestPlaces comfort index, Litchfield Park scores 9.1% better than West Palm Beach
